Christos Gage talks 'Sunset'
Christos Gage has discussed his Top Cow miniseries Sunset.

The Absolution and Avengers: The Initiative writer's six-issue miniseries previewed in The Darkness #78.

Sunset tells the story of retired war veteran Nick Bellamy, who finds himself haunted by ghosts from his past.

Gage explained the inspiration behind the series to Newsarama, saying: "It came from two places. A trip to old Vegas several years ago - the gritty, no nonsense Vegas of Fremont Street - and a number of true-life stories that my wife Ruth and I had noticed about older people who, for want of better words, kick ass.

"There was one about a Korean War vet who was buying something at a convenience store when a young man tried to grab his money and the older man laid him out with one punch. Turns out he was a former Golden Gloves champ."

He continued: "A 74-year-old senior citizen in New York, when confronted by a 32-year-old robber wielding a tire iron, got out of his car, took the weapon away from the man and chased him through a parking lot.

"So we got to thinking about what it would be like to do a story about people in this age group... a hard-edged, noir-ish action epic... sort of a modern Wild Bunch."

Sunset is illustrated by Jorge Lucas (Iron Man, The Incredible Hulk) and will debut in 2010.
